49 /// The main interface class. This class coordinates the communication to
50 /// a single handheld. This class also owns the only Usb::Device object
51 /// the handheld. All other classes reference this one for the low level
52 /// device object. This class owns the only SocketZero object as well,
53 /// which is the object that any SocketRoutingQueue is plugged into
54 /// if constructed that way.
56 /// To use this class, use the following steps:
58 /// - Probe the USB bus for matching devices with the Probe class
59 /// - Create an optional SocketRoutingQueue object and create a
60 /// read thread for it, or use its default read thread.
61 /// - Pass one of the probe results into the Controller constructor
62 /// to connect to the USB device. Pass the routing queue
63 /// to the Controller constructor here too, if needed.
64 /// - Create the Mode object of your choice. See m_desktop.h
65 /// and m_serial.h for these mode classes. You pass
66 /// your controller object into these mode constructors
67 /// to create the mode.
